Polyethylene terephthalate (PET) is a versatile thermoplastic polymer widely used due to its excellent properties such as high tensile strength, low weight, and good barrier properties against moisture and gases. PET is primarily used in the production of plastic bottles and containers for beverages like water, soda, and juices due to its lightweight and recyclable nature. In addition to packaging, PET is also utilized in various textile applications; when extruded into fibers, it is commonly known as polyester. Polyester fabrics made from PET are popular in clothing, upholstery, and carpeting because of their durability and resistance to wrinkles, mildew, and moisture. Furthermore, PET is employed in the manufacturing of medical devices, such as catheters and syringes, thanks to its biocompatibility and sterilizability. Lastly, it finds application in engineering resins and films, which are used in automotive parts, electrical insulation, and photographic films. Given its widespread use, consumers should be aware of PET's presence in many daily-use products and consider recycling options to minimize environmental impact.
To epoxy grout shower walls, start by thoroughly cleaning the tile surface and removing any old grout or debris. Mix the epoxy grout according to the manufacturer's instructions, ensuring a consistent texture. Apply the grout using a rubber float, working it into the joints in a diagonal motion. Press firmly to ensure deep penetration into the gaps. Wipe away excess grout with a damp sponge, being cautious not to remove grout from the joints. Allow the grout to set as per the manufacturer's recommended time before applying a final clean-up of any haze with a clean cloth. Epoxy grout is preferred for its durability and resistance to moisture and stains, making it ideal for shower walls.
For inkjet printers, paper GSM (grams per square meter) influences the print quality and durability. Generally, a GSM range of 90 to 250 is suitable for most inkjet printing tasks. Lighter papers (90-150 GSM) are ideal for everyday printing, while heavier papers (200-250 GSM) offer better durability and are preferred for photographs, presentations, and promotional materials. The higher the GSM, the thicker and more absorbent the paper, resulting in less bleed-through and more vivid colors. It's important to balance your specific needs with your printer's capabilities, as excessively heavyweight paper can cause jamming in some inkjet printers. Always consult your printer's manual for the maximum GSM it can handle.
